On26 October 2023, University of Economics Ho Chi Minh City (UEH University) is delighted to announce the commencement of a groundbreaking project titled "Sustainable Development in the European Union: Jean Monnet Interdisciplinary Module". This initiative has received financing from the European Union under the prestigious Jean Monnet Actions of the Erasmus programme.

This project marks a significant milestone for UEH, being the first-ever Jean Monnet Actions project to be financed at our esteemed institution. Such an achievement places UEH University among a select group of universities in Vietnam; to date, fewer than 10 universities in the country have been awarded Jean Monnet Actions projects. This recognition solidifies UEH's commitment to advancing academic excellence and global partnerships.

The project is aimed at enhancing the understanding of sustainable development in Vietnam, which, despite its commitment to global sustainability standards, ranks only 55th in the Global Sustainability Index.

In the words of Dr. Hai - Yen Hoang, "Vietnam's journey towards sustainability is pivotal, and through the EU4Sustainability project, we aim to offer higher education students the cognitive tools they need to comprehend the EU's role as a global promoter of sustainable development."

Dr. Hai-Yen Hoang - Dean School of Banking, UEH University will be leading this ambitious project as the academic coordinator.

Over the coming months, UEH students and the larger community can look forward to a series of enlightening courses, delivered by esteemed lecturers from UEH and global experts. The courses include:

  1. Sustainable Development as a Global Trend (15 hours)
  2. Sustainable Development Goals in European Agenda (15 hours)
  3. EU Sustainable Finance and Investment (15 hours)
  4. The European Sustainable Society as Research Item (15 hours)
  5. Sustainable Development in EU External Relations (15 hours)
  6. Sustainable Development and General Principles of EU Law (15 hours)
  7. The EU Green Deal: Prospects and Challenges (15 hours)

In addition to these courses, a dedicated webpage for the project will soon be launched. This platform will provide free access to all the learning materials and results of the project for students, university staff, and the public at large.
